Summary:The rare semileptonic \(\chi_{c1}(1p)\rightarrow D_{s}^{+}e\bar{\nu }\) decay is analyzed, by using the three-point QCD sum rules. Taking into account the two-gluon condensate contributions, the transition form factors related to this decay are calculated and are used to determine the total decay width and branching fraction. Our findings may be approved by future experiments.
